Features

Existing Features

This is a web application which that allows users to store and easily access cooking recipes. It is a full stack web application (frontend and backend) that provides CRUD (Create, Read, Update, Delete) functionality to a database hosted in the cloud on Heroku platform as a service. Users can :

  1. Recipe Search: search by recipe name, search by ingredient and filter recipes by category, course, cuisine and author on the index page.
  2. Add Recipe: Add a new recipe and then Add ingredients and methods to the recipe on the recipe detail page.
  3. Manage Categories: Add new and Edit existing static data like categories, courses, cuisines, authors, measurements etc.
  4. My Recipes: view a list of recipes submitted by the current logged in user.
  5. Saved Recipes: view and manage a list of recipes saved by the current logged in user.
  6. Dashboard: displays interactive dashboard of charts; Categories bar chart, courses pie chart, cuisines row chart and author bar chart.
  7. Recipe Detail: Save, Edit and Delete recipes, Edit and Delete ingredients, Edit and Delete methods.

Deployment

  1. Make sure requirements.txt and Procfile exist: pip3 freeze --local requirements.txt echo web: python app.py > Procfile
  2. Create Heroku App, Select Postgres add-on, download Heroku CLI toolbelt, login to heroku (Heroku login), git init, connect git to heroku (heroku git remote -a ), git add ., git commit, git push heroku master.
  3. heroku ps:scale web=1
  4. In heroku app settings set the config vars to add DATABASE_URL, IP and PORT
